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
95 814160 932265
52 041127
52 041127
3847 38524642740 00 17 76
All about undefined
Interested in learning more?
52 041127
3847 38524642740 00 17 76
See more
53 082139 645195339
8283045867 0248 6361625
See more
36927 260856421 8009
9854854 8861772 015301875
See more